> I'm thinking you can't simply unlink a file given by a user inside
> a libraray unconditionaly. Say, what if a user gives a wrong socket
> path?
Well... We can improve the security by checking that:
a) The file exists and it's a socket.
b) Nobody is listening on it.
> I normally write a short script to handle it automatically.
I know, you can always hack up some kludges, just IMHO it's not production-grade solution. What if you are cloud administrator, and
you have 1000 users, each of them using 100 vhost-user interfaces? List all of them in some script? Too huge job, i would say.
And without it the thing just appears to be too fragile, requiring manual maintenance after a single stupid failure.
